← All Positions
Posted Mar 19, 2026

Artificial Intelligence (AI) Developer – Dynamics Contact Center Solutions

Apply Now
Job Title: Artificial Intelligence (AI) Developer – Dynamics Contact Center Location: Hybrid (Mostly Remote – 1 week/month travel to Middletown, PA) Duration: Long Term Job Description: We are seeking an experienced AI Developer to design and implement intelligent automation solutions for Dynamics Contact Center environments. The role involves developing AI-powered voice bots, chatbots, NLP models, and intelligent routing to enhance customer engagement across omnichannel support platforms. Key Responsibilities: • Design and develop AI solutions for contact centers, including virtual assistants for voice and chat. • Build NLP models to analyze customer interactions across voice, chat, email, and social channels. • Develop chatbots and voice bots using Microsoft Copilot Studio and Azure AI. • Integrate AI capabilities with Microsoft Dynamics 365 and enterprise applications. • Monitor and optimize AI/ML model performance and customer interaction workflows. • Collaborate with business and technical teams and maintain technical documentation. Required Skills: • 5+ years of experience in AI / Machine Learning development • Strong Python programming skills • Experience with TensorFlow or PyTorch • Experience with NLP libraries (spaCy, Hugging Face, NLTK) • Hands-on experience with Dynamics Contact Center solutions • Experience building chatbots and voice bots • Experience deploying AI models on Azure Cloud Preferred Skills: • Voice AI / Speech-to-Text technologies • Experience with Apache Kafka or Apache Spark • Knowledge of contact center platforms such as Zendesk, Salesforce Service Cloud, or Amazon Connect